Filipino designer Veejay Floresca has turned patience into triumph, securing a major challenge win on Project Runway Season 21 after more than two decades of perseverance.
Floresca, now based in New York, first revealed that it took 21 years of auditioning and rejections before finally earning a spot on the iconic American fashion reality series.
“I patiently waited for 21 years to finally be part of this iconic show. I auditioned every season and was rejected many times, but I told myself to never give up,” she shared in a post ahead of the premiere.

Her persistence paid off. In Episode 5, Floresca impressed the judges with a striking look under the theme “Runway Look Inspired by an Unconventional Fabric Creation.” The standout detail, a tote bag described as “so beautiful and chic”, earned her the top spot for the week and cemented her status as a serious contender this season.

Floresca is no stranger to fashion competitions. She first appeared on Project Runway Philippines in 2008 and has since built a successful career, dressing Miss Universe queens Pia Wurtzbach and Rabiya Mateo, as well as beauty icons Gazini Ganados, Venus Raj, and Katrina Dimaranan. Beyond her design work, she also made headlines in 2022 when she represented the Philippines at the Miss Trans Star International pageant, finishing in the Top 16.

Now, with Heidi Klum, Nina Garcia, Law Roach, and Christian Siriano looking on, Floresca’s latest achievement highlights not only her creative skill but also her resilience. Fans across the Philippines and the LGBTQ+ community have celebrated the win as a moment of collective pride.
Though Project Runway Season 21 is still underway, Floresca’s Episode 5 triumph already stands as a milestone, proof that perseverance, artistry, and authenticity can shine on one of fashion’s biggest stage.
